River Detectives Program:

The Year 7 students are currently participating in the River Detectives program, an initiative that helps students develop an understanding of local waterways and environmental sustainability.

 

As part of the program, students visit the river once each term to conduct water quality testing and collect data. This Friday, the students will be heading to the river to carry out another round of testing, allowing them to monitor changes in water quality over time and contribute to ongoing environmental investigations.
